| Synonymy: |
desdemona Edwards, 1881 (Catocala) - MONA 1983: [NEW]; TL: Prescott, AZ.ixion Druce, 1890 (Catocala)swetti Barnes & Benjamin, 1927 (Catocala)umbra Barnes & Benjamin, 1927 (Catocala)utahensis Cassino, 1918 (Catocala) |
| Taxonomic Notes: |
Catocala desdemona Edwards, 1881, formerly treated as a subspecies of 8835 Catocala delilah Strecker, 1874, is returned to full species status and includes as synonyms Catocala ixion Druce, 1890 and Catocala delilah form utahensis Cassino, 1918 in Hawks (2010), ZooKeys, 39: 18. |
